
Al Ortago, 81, of Puryear, Tennessee, passed away Wednesday, October 19, 2022, at his residence.
Al Ortago was born Wednesday, September 11, 1941, in Newberry, Michigan, to the late Daniel Charles Ortago and the late Marie Anguilm Ortago. Besides his parents, Al was also preceded in death by a daughter: Holly Smith; a grandchild: Michael Alan Platt; and a sister: Kathleen Bradley.
Al was a Veteran of the United States Navy and a member of Tennessee Valley Community Church.
Saturday, July 30, 1994, he married Jill Clements Ortago, who survives in Puryear, Tennesssee.
In addition to his wife, Al is also survived by two daughters: Kelly (Henrik) McVoy of Milford, CT, and Michelle Ortago (Michael Nowlin) of Stamford, CT; five grandchildren: Lyric McVoy, Abby McVoy, Ethan McVoy, Hunter (Natalia) Smith, and Zach Smith; and brother-in-law, Jerry Bradley of Warren, MI.
His celebration of life service will be at 1:00 p.m. Monday, October 24, 2022, at McEvoy Funeral Home, 507 W. Washington St. in Paris with Carlton Gerrell of Tennessee Valley Community Church officiating. Visitation with the family will be after 11:00 a.m. Monday until the time of service at McEvoy Funeral Home.
